Jannik

A Scandinavian form of Jan rooted in the Hebrew John, meaning 'God's gracious gift.' Jannik is especially popular in Denmark and Germany, where it maintains a strong, straightforward character with underlying warmth. The -ik ending is distinctly Northern European, evoking both tradition and contemporary appeal.
